The cross section is a triangle with three equal sides measuring more than 6 feet.

What is a cube?

A cube is a solid three dimensional shape with 6 faces or squares of equal length.

Analysis:

The diagonal of one face of the cube forms right angle triangle with the adjacent sides of that face of the cube.

So using Pythagoras to find length,

[tex]diagonal^{2}[/tex] = [tex]6^{2}[/tex] + [tex]6^{2}[/tex]

[tex]diagonal^{2}[/tex] = 36 + 36

[tex]diagonal^{2}[/tex] = 72

diagonal = [tex]\sqrt{72}[/tex] = 8.48 feet. Which is same form the remaining two diagonals forming the triangle.

Therefore the cross section is a triangle with three equal sides with length greater than 6  feet.
